Welding and Metalworks: involves fabricating, shaping, and joining metal components using techniques like MIG/MAGS, TIG, and arc welding to create durable structures.

It includes cutting, bending, and assembling materials for industrial or structural applications. Key skills involve interpreting blueprints, ensuring structural integrity, and adhering to safety procedures.

Key Aspects of Welding and Metalworks

Welding Processes:

Techniques such as Gas Metal Arc Welding (MIG), Metal Inert Gas (MAG), Manual Metal Arc (MMA), and TIG are utilized for joining metal, often with filler materials.

Metalworking Techniques:

This includes cutting (plasma, oxy-acetylene), bending, shaping, and assembling raw metal into finished products.

Fabrication:

The end-to-end process of transforming metal, which involves creating templates, welding components together, and finishing surfaces.

Applications:

Ranging from industrial machinery, structural steel, and pipeline welding to precision parts and agricultural equipment repairs.
